Decoding Your DVLA Summary – A Step-by-Step Guide
Understanding your copyright summary from the DVLA can feel overwhelming , but it doesn’t have to be! This easy guide will explain the key areas. First, check your personal details ; ensure your title and address are up-to-date. Next, pay close attention to the entitlement categories – these display what type of vehicle you’re able to drive. Any endorsements will be clearly stated , so meticulously read these. Finally, observe the creation and expiry deadlines; these are crucial for renewing your authorisation.
